WHO's Updated PCV Position Paper: 1p+1 Schedules for National Programs

This webinar, held on 22 April 2026, examined recent developments in pneumococcal conjugate vaccine (PCV) policy. The programme included:

  • An overview of the updated WHO Position Paper on PCV (World Health Organization)
  • A presentation on the Systematic review of evidence supporting PCV 1+1 schedules (Murdoch Children’s Research Institute)
  • An analysis of pneumococcal disease trends following a switch to a 1+1 schedule, drawing on the UK experience (UK Health Security Agency)
  • A discussion of PCV decision‑making within the Vaccine Prioritization and Optimization Process (VPOP) (UNICEF and World Health Organization)
